
The UC1000 /LYTER-NHN series analyzer measures the concentrations of nitrate nitrogen and ammonia nitrogen in water by using the ion-selective electrode method. It directly detects the nitrate concentration in the water environment through the nitrate ion-selective electrode and determines the ammonia nitrogen concentration by directly detecting the ammonium ions in the water environment through the ammonia ion-selective electrode. The sensor uses a pH electrode as the reference electrode, thereby achieving better stability. Because the measurement results are easily affected by interfering ions, when the concentration of interfering ions in water is relatively high, the online measurement system can adopt the automatic ion compensation function to achieve the best measurement effect.
